Just the Basics SCORE- Charleston 3, UVA Wise 1 TEAM RECORDS - Charleston (15-16, 14-5 MEC), UVA Wise (2-14) How It Happened The Golden Eagles defeated the Cavaliers of UVA Wise on Friday night in 4 sets. The Golden Eagles battled Early with the Cavaliers as play was even during the first 10 points. The Golden Eagles rallied, pulled away and won by a score of 25-15. Janeese Vervelde and Carly Granger led UC with 6 kills each.
The Golden Eagles dominated in the second set as well, winning by a score of 25-15 for a second straight set. UC never looked challenged in the second set as they rolled to an easy victory. Carly Granger added 5 kills. Senior Chloe Massaro earned her 2,000th career assist and was recognized during the game. The Golden Eagles won the set on an attack error by Wise's Madelyn Gibson.
The Golden Eagles were challenged in the third set and were defeated after tough play from the Cavaliers. They lost by a score of 25-22.
In the fourth set marked another victory for the Golden Eagles. They closed it out with excellent team play and scrappy defense. The Golden Eagle attack proved to be too much for the Cavaliers as UC rolled to a 26-16 victory. Tori Clark and Janeese Vervelde led UC with 4 kills each as UC finally bounced back from their previous home defeat to West Virginia State.
